Dust settling velocity under low-density atmospheres using TR-PIV

  • 1. ROR icon Stanford University

Description

These two MATLAB scripts enable the calculation of: (i) the Knudsen number (Kn) as a function of the settling Reynolds number (Re) under typical conditions on Mars and Earth, and (ii) the probability density functions (PDFs) of the slip-coefficient parameters obtained from Monte Carlo modeling.
